Title: translation of "order_status_name"
Post by: GuidoS on February 11, 2014, 22:10:12 PM
When I installed a new clean virtuemart 2.0.26d a came up with the problem that the order status are not translated. When you look on the statistic page on the frontpage of virtuemart you will see the untranslated names like "COM_VIRTUEMART_ORDER_STATUS_PENDING". When I look in the code I see the following "echo $row->order_status_name;" and not the method to translate. In my older installations of virtuemart I don't have this issue, I think because those strings are in the database as translated strings (english) and not my backend language Dutch. I saw this on several pages in the backend, don't no what it will do in emails, etc.

The translated strings are in the language file, bot for english as dutch.
